## Build Provenance: Leaked File Descriptor Hunt

Plugin authors for the Quillbarrow toolchain should note that build 4.2 closed a long-standing descriptor leak in the sandbox spawner. Plugins that held pipes open past teardown were silently inheriting stale handles, corrupting provenance attestations. Verify your plugin against the hardened spawner before publishing. The attestation record for the fixed build follows below.

build token for yajof-bajof: htk31_506ff1188f74596b5bb2eec94edc43c

Subject: Eventspine cut-over done

Team,

Cut-over of the event schema registry from the old Ledgerline instance to Eventspine completed last night. All producers re-pointed; consumers validated against v2 compatibility mode. Old registry is read-only until end of month, then decommissioned. Rollback window has passed. Known gap: the batch exporter still caches schemas for 24h, so stale reads are possible until tomorrow. Nothing else outstanding.

For reference, the new registry runs with the following configuration.

settings of yageg-yahap:
[gorael]
team = olieth
access_code = ac_941d74
owner = brieth.aldiel
host = gorael.tolvaqio.internal
port = 6379
peer = briwyn.urlaqtech.internal
salt = 116e6622
pin = 1957

## TICKET: Config drift — order cutoff rule

The Mazarine bakery app's order-cutoff time differs between prod and staging. Prod cuts off at 14:00, staging at 16:00, and nobody updated the source-of-truth file. Orders placed in the gap silently fail fulfillment. New folks: always edit the canonical file, never the node directly. Current prod values for reference follow.

config for haweg-bagag:
[kasath]
host = kasath.qirvancorp.internal
user = kasath_svc
database = kasath_prod